Team Building Activity: Your Talents

Your Talents is a brief team building activity that brings people together in a meaningful way. Gather your group in a circle and ask everyone to think for a moment about what their talents are. Ask them to focus on their real talents, the things that are meaningful to them and they love doing. After people think about it, ask everyone to share what their talents are. Have each person talk about their meaningful talents while everyone else listens. No commenting or follow-up questions or comments allowed when people are talking, just listening. Have each person talk once and remind the group to keep it brief but meaningful. When everyone's had a chance to share once then ask the group the following questions:
  • What did you notice about this activity?
  • What was the feeling in the room?
  • What needed to happen to make this activity possible?
  • How can you apply this experience to team building in your workplace?
The idea in this team building activity is to demonstrate the amazing gifts that people bring to the table and help people connect by learning about each other without the noise and interruptions that commonly happen in the workplace. It also suggest ways to use people's unique talents.
